Abstract

The invention discloses a sea water desalination device based on pressure retardation osmosis and reverse osmosis and a method thereof. The sea water desalination device comprises a concentration difference power unit, a sea water desalination unit and a pressure transfer element positioned between the concentration difference power unit and the sea water desalination unit. The concentration difference power unit comprises a hollow seal water chamber No. 1, a hollow concentrated seawater chamber adjacent to the hollow seal water chamber No. 1, and an osmotic membrane positioned between the hollow seal water chamber No. 1 and the hollow concentrated seawater chamber, and the concentration difference power unit is used for converting salinity gradient power of sea water with different concentrations into static pressure. The sea water desalination unit comprises a hollow seal water chamber No. 2, a hollow fresh water chamber adjacent to the hollow seal water chamber No. 2, and a reverse osmosis membrane positioned between the hollow seal water chamber No. 2 and the hollow fresh water chamber, and under the effect of static pressure, the reverse osmosis membrane only allows water molecules to pass through, thereby achieving sea water desalination. The pressure transfer element can move or deform, and transfers static pressure to the seal water chamber No.2 through self moving or deforming. The device has a compact structure, only uses seawater salinity gradient energy for sea water desalination, does not consume high-grade energy and is green and environmental-friendly.

Description

technical field

[0001] The invention belongs to the technical field of seawater desalination, and in particular relates to a seawater desalination device based on pressure-delayed osmosis and reverse osmosis utilizing salinity difference energy and a method thereof. Background technique

[0002] At present, a large number of offshore islands and rocky reefs are scarce in fresh water resources, and there is an urgent need to use seawater desalination technology to prepare fresh water. Traditional seawater desalination technologies mainly include: seawater freezing method, electrodialysis method, distillation method, and reverse osmosis membrane method. Among them, the distillation method and the reverse osmosis membrane method are the main desalination methods, both of which rely on electric energy.
